The Impact of Abandoned Carts on WooCommerce Sales

Abandoned carts are a common occurrence in the WooCommerce world. In fact, studies have shown that the average cart abandonment rate can be as high as 70%. That’s a staggering number of potential sales going down the drain.

When a customer adds items to their cart but fails to complete the purchase, it represents a missed opportunity for your business. It could be due to various reasons such as unexpected costs, complicated checkout process, or simply getting distracted.

Regardless of the reason, abandoned carts directly impact your WooCommerce store sales.

Essential Elements of a Successful Abandoned Cart Email

While the content of your abandoned cart emails may vary depending on your business and target audience, there are a few essential elements that should be present in every email:

  • A catchy subject line that grabs attention and stands out from other emails. We all get barrages of emails every day.
  • A clear and concise message that reminds customers of the items they left in their carts.
  • A compelling call-to-action that encourages customers to click through to their carts and complete the purchase.
  • Incentives such as discounts or free shipping to sweeten the deal.

Optimizing Your Abandoned Cart Email Strategy With A/B Testing

Cart Email Strategy With Testing

Now that your abandoned cart emails are up and running, it’s time to optimize your strategy for maximum effectiveness.

A/B testing involves sending different versions of your abandoned cart emails to different subsets of your audience and analyzing the results to determine which copy, design, and imagery performs better.

Through this process, you can constantly refine and improve your email content, subject lines, and overall approach. The data generated can help to inform your strategy going forward.

Measuring the Success of Your Abandoned Cart Email Campaign

Tracking the performance of your abandoned cart email campaign is crucial to assess its effectiveness and identify areas for improvement. This is effectively an experiment, and it is important to work out what is going to work for your site.

Key Metrics to Track for Abandoned Cart Emails

Analytics tools can help you to work out how well your emails are performing. Some key metrics you should be monitoring include.

  • Open rate: The percentage of recipients who open your emails.
  • Click-through rate: The percentage of recipients who click on the call-to-action in your emails.
  • Conversion rate: The percentage of recipients who make a purchase after clicking through to their abandoned carts.
  • Revenue generated: The total revenue generated from your abandoned cart email campaign, ultimately the most important metric.
